Jennie Edmundson Hospital Family Resource Center
Health Information for Our Patients and Their Families
One of the most comprehensive facilities of its kind in the Midwest, Jennie Edmundson Family Resource Center provides free, current, easy-to-understand consumer health information to the public, through a lending library of books and videos, online computer searches, customized health information packets and community outreach.
